From microstructural features to macroscopic traits

Title From microstructural features to macroscopic traits
Lecturer Prof. Anja Geitmann (Canada Research Chair in Biomechanics of Plant Development, Department of Plant Science, McGill University)
Language English
Date&Time 01/20/2026 (Tue) 16:00~17:00
Venue L12
Detail

Abstract: The analysis of structure-function relationships in biology must integrate features at multiple length scales. Cell morphogenetic processes occurring during plant development are crucial determinants of metabolic and mechanical functionality of mature organs. Through 4D imaging, computational modeling and micromechanical testing we can obtain a deeper understanding of the hierarchical architectural concepts underpinning metabolic processes.
